jqrey表单提交及回显

可能就自己能看懂 ,

<!DOCTYPE html>
<html>
    <head>
        <meta charset="utf-8">
        <title></title>
    </head>
    <script type="text/javascript" src="js/jquery-1.8.2.min.js" ></script>
    <script type="text/javascript">

        function aa(){
            //alert("a");



            /*var h=$("h1").html();
            alert(h)*/
            //$("body").html("<p>aaaa</p>");

            //$("#single").val("Single2");
            //$("select[name='sel']").val("Single2")
            //$("#multiple").val(["Multiple2", "Multiple3"]);
            //$("input").val(["百合", "radio1"]);
            //下拉框alert($("#single").val())选中后打印
            //$("input[value='check1']").attr("checked",true)
            //$("input[value='radio1']").attr("checked",true)
            //$("#text").focus();

            /*var a=$("input[name=radio]:checked").val()
            alert(a)*/
            //$("input[name='radio'][value='radio1']").attr("checked",true)
            //$(":radio").val(["radio1"]);


            /*var a="啦啦1,百合2,3";
            var aa=a.split(",");
            for (var i in aa) {
                $(":checkbox[value="+aa[i]+"]").attr("checked",true)
            }*/

            //必须放一个数组
            /*var a=["啦啦1","百合2","3"];
            $("input[name='check']").val(a);*/

            //$("input[name='check']").val(["啦啦1","百合2"])
                //$("input").val(["百合", "radio1"]);
                //$(":radio").val(["radio1"]);
            /*$(":checkbox[name='check']:checked").map(function(n){
                    alert($(this).val()+n);
                })*/

            /*不用拿到map也可以打印
             * var a=$("input:checked");
            for(var i in a){
                alert($(a[i]).val())
            }*/

            /*把所有checked的值放到a中
             * var a=$("input:checked").map(function(){
            return $(this).val();
            }).get().join(", ") 
            alert(a);*/

            //全选$(":checkbox[name='check']").attr("checked",true);
            /*反选$(":checkbox[name='check']").map(function(){
                if($(this).is(":checked")){
                    $(this).attr("checked",false);
                    //$(this).val([]);
                }else{
                    $(this).attr("checked",true);
                }
            })*/

            //这个是按键后触发事件$("#p").append("123");


            /*一定不能用id去选择CheckBox 和radio 因为 id只会选择一个;
             * $("#ckeck").attr("checked",true)*/
            }


    </script>
    <body>

            <h1>啦啦啦啦</h1><br />

        <select id="single" name="sel">
          <option>Single</option>
          <option>Single2</option>
          <option value="1" >Single3</option>
        </select><br />


        <select id="multiple" multiple="multiple">
          <option selected="selected">Multiple1</option>
          <option>Multiple2</option>
          <option selected="selected">Multiple3</option>
        </select><br/>


        <input type="checkbox" name="check" id="ckeck" value="啦啦1"/> 啦啦
        <input type="checkbox" name="check" id="ckeck" value="百合2"/> 百合
        <input type="checkbox" name="check" id="ckeck" value="3"/> 搞基
        <input type="checkbox" name="check" id="ckeck" value="4"/> 乱伦
        <br />


        <input type="radio" name="radio" id="radio" value="radio1"/> radio1
        <input type="radio" name="radio" id="radio" value="radio2"/> radio2
        <br />

        <p id="p" >aa</p>
        <input type="text" id="text" name="tt" onkeydown="aa()"  />
        <button onclick="aa()">点我</button>
    <div style="display: none;"></div>
    </body>

</html>
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值